java设置触发事件点击button1跳转界面1,当点击button2跳转到界面2
时间: 2024-03-02 20:49:51 浏览: 84
好的,针对您的问题,可以使用以下代码实现:
```
button1.addActionListener(new ActionListener() {
public void actionPerformed(ActionEvent e) {
// 跳转到界面1的代码
}
});
button2.addActionListener(new ActionListener() {
public void actionPerformed(ActionEvent e) {
// 跳转到界面2的代码
}
});
```
在这段代码中,我们使用了Java中的ActionListener接口来监听按钮的点击事件。当用户点击button1时,会执行跳转到界面1的代码;当用户点击button2时,会执行跳转到界面2的代码。
需要注意的是,跳转界面的具体实现方式取决于您使用的GUI框架。如果您使用的是Swing,则可以使用JFrame或JDialog来实现界面的跳转。如果您使用的是JavaFX,则可以使用Stage和Scene来实现界面的跳转。
相关问题
我想设置一个按钮button,点击后触发事件跳转至设置好的锚点,应该怎么做
你可以使用JavaScript来实现这个功能。
首先,在HTML中定义一个按钮元素,并为其设置一个id属性,例如:
```html
<button id="myButton">跳转到锚点</button>
```
接下来,在JavaScript中获取这个按钮元素,并为它添加一个点击事件处理程序。在事件处理程序中,使用`window.location.hash`属性将页面的URL设置为目标锚点。例如:
```javascript
var myButton = document.getElementById("myButton");
myButton.addEventListener('click', function() {
window.location.hash = "#myAnchor";
});
```
在上面的代码中,`myAnchor`是你想要跳转到的锚点的名称。当用户点击按钮时,页面将滚动到这个锚点。如果你还没有在页面中定义这个锚点,可以在HTML中使用`<a>`标签来定义它,如下所示:
```html
<a name="myAnchor"></a>
```
这个锚点可以放在任何你想要滚动到的位置。
jquery mobile 使用button 跳转界面
你可以通过使用`<a>`标签或者JavaScript代码来实现跳转界面的功能。
方法一:使用`<a>`标签
使用`<a>`标签来创建一个按钮,并设置`href`属性为目标页面的URL,当点击按钮时,页面会自动跳转到目标页面。
示例代码:
```html
<a href="目标页面的URL" data-role="button">跳转</a>
```
注意:需要在按钮的`<a>`标签上添加`data-role="button"`属性,以使按钮样式生效。
方法二:使用JavaScript代码
使用JavaScript的`window.location.href`属性来实现页面跳转。你可以在点击按钮时触发JavaScript函数,然后在函数中使用`window.location.href`实现页面跳转。
示例代码:
```html
<button onclick="跳转函数()">跳转</button>
<script>
function 跳转函数() {
window.location.href = "目标页面的URL";
}
</script>
```
将"目标页面的URL"替换为你要跳转的页面的URL。
以上是使用jQuery Mobile实现按钮跳转界面的两种方法。你可以根据具体的需求选择其中一种方法来使用。
阅读全文